Output 84ff33e209af35fd496b13310ec7c4f65b227bf43f9897351dde48f95a6077b6:2

value
502000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5c2b64e59e8f65564c0f0f3cc8c50f6d1a0123b OP_EQUAL
address
3JG5V6pppeeDqkYPNc91fR7gWJ2JbhPyAp
transaction
84ff33e209af35fd496b13310ec7c4f65b227bf43f9897351dde48f95a6077b6
confirmations
332378
spent
true